Scoreboard (other) : 1. (Noun?) To deny, via pointing at the scoreboard, charges from an opposing team in sports that your win against them was unjustly obtained. OR 2. (verb) Scoreboarded. To "scoreboard" someone to point out that regardless of their opinion on whether or not they are better than you, you still won.
The [Philadelphia] Eagles complained that because they did not have T.O. [T. Owens], that the [Pittsburgh] Steelers' win against them, 14-6, was diminished. "Scoreboard." —Jim Rome, various listeners, The Jim Rome Show, other sports shows
